About

Jiubing Cheng is a scholar working on Geophysics, Ocean Engineering and Mechanical Engineering. According to data from OpenAlex, Jiubing Cheng has authored 84 papers receiving a total of 737 indexed citations (citations by other indexed papers that have themselves been cited), including 83 papers in Geophysics, 47 papers in Ocean Engineering and 22 papers in Mechanical Engineering. Recurrent topics in Jiubing Cheng's work include Seismic Imaging and Inversion Techniques (83 papers), Seismic Waves and Analysis (64 papers) and Drilling and Well Engineering (22 papers). Jiubing Cheng is often cited by papers focused on Seismic Imaging and Inversion Techniques (83 papers), Seismic Waves and Analysis (64 papers) and Drilling and Well Engineering (22 papers). Jiubing Cheng collaborates with scholars based in China, Norway and United States. Jiubing Cheng's co-authors include Tengfei Wang, Sergey Fomel, Jianhua Geng, Wei Kang, Børge Arntsen, Zaitian Ma, Tariq Alkhalifah, Luanxiao Zhao, Huazhong Wang and De‐hua Han and has published in prestigious journals such as Journal of Computational Physics, Geophysical Research Letters and IEEE Transactions on Geoscience and Remote Sensing.
